Pockets Full of Memories Data Archive

You are at the "Pockets Full of Memories" (PFOM) data archive site consisting of data contributed by the public visiting the PFOM exhibitions between 2001 and 2007. The data analysis is led by George Legrady and Brigitte Steinheider. Database construction and design by August Black. Funded through a Research Across Disciplines Award, Office of Research, UC Santa Barbara.
